Abstract: | Results of an experimental and theoretical analysis of Kol'skii's method for dynamic tests of soft soils in an elastic casing
are presented. The model proposed by S. S. Grigoryan for a plastically compressible medium with parameters determined in shock-wave
experiments was used as the model of a soft soil. The high-rate deformation of the soil was simulated using a modified “Dunamics-2”
program package. The numerical calculations performed showed that the compliance of the casing and friction practically do
not influence the measured characteristics of the soil and the basic premises of Kol'skii's method are adequate for soft soil
too.
